AT 06:52am this morning, Tuesday (Aug 25), crews from Whitland, Carmarthen and Swansea Central attended a water rescue at a camp site near St Clears.
Nine people and two dogs were rescued, from the flooded camp site, by Fire Service personnel using a swift rescue sledge, lines and wading gear.
The Fire Service left the incident at 09:17am.
